Covering part of Wetzel County, West Virginia, ZIP Code 26437 has about 476 residents. At $68,750, its median household income sits above Wetzel County's $53,341.

Between 2019 and 2023, ZIP Code 26437's population declined 11.7% from 539 to 476.

Households average 2.59 people. 1.5% of adults 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
